texte = My shopping cart page is being cached by the web browser, so it doesn'tnecessarily reflect the true state of the cart. For example, if I view myshopping cart page and it says "your shopping cart is empty" and then I adda product to the cart, it still says it's empty when I return to theshopping cart page. If I refresh my browser, it shows the item in the cart.I've got template caching turned off in WebDNA, Performance Cache turned offin my OS X Admin server settings and I've even tried the following in myshopping cart page:
